Cultivating Critical Thinking: The Key to Academic Success in Higher Education

In today’s complex and ever-changing world, the ability to think critically has become an invaluable skill for students in higher education. Critical thinking enables individuals to analyze information, evaluate different perspectives, and make informed decisions. As universities strive to prepare students for successful careers and responsible citizenship, fostering critical thinking skills has emerged as a key educational priority. This article delves into the significance of critical thinking in higher education, exploring its benefits, challenges, and strategies for implementation. One of the primary reasons critical thinking is essential in higher education is its role in enhancing academic performance. Students equipped with strong critical thinking skills can engage more deeply with course material, allowing them to synthesize information and draw meaningful connections between concepts. This depth of understanding not only leads to improved grades but also cultivates a genuine love for learning. In contrast, students who rely solely on rote memorization often struggle to apply their knowledge in practical situations, hindering their long-term academic and professional success. Furthermore, critical thinking is crucial for effective problem-solving. In a world characterized by rapid technological advancements and global challenges, employers increasingly seek individuals who can navigate complexity and devise innovative solutions. By nurturing critical thinking skills, universities prepare students to tackle real-world problems with confidence and creativity. For example, a student studying environmental science may be tasked with developing sustainable solutions to reduce carbon emissions. Through critical analysis and evaluation of various approaches, they can identify the most effective strategies to address this pressing issue. Despite its importance, promoting critical thinking in higher education is not without challenges. One significant hurdle is the traditional focus on standardized testing and assessment methods that prioritize memorization over analytical skills. Many students are accustomed to a passive learning approach, where they absorb information without actively engaging with it. To counteract this trend, universities must adopt teaching methods that encourage active participation and critical inquiry. Strategies such as inquiry-based learning, case studies, and group discussions can stimulate students’ curiosity and foster a culture of critical thinking. For instance, in a philosophy class, students can engage in debates on ethical dilemmas, encouraging them to articulate their viewpoints while considering opposing perspectives. Another challenge is the varying levels of critical thinking skills among students entering higher education. Some learners may have had limited exposure to critical thinking exercises in their previous education, making it essential for universities to provide support and resources to bridge this gap. Orientation programs, workshops, and introductory courses can be designed to equip students with the foundational skills necessary for effective critical thinking. Additionally, faculty members play a vital role in promoting critical thinking within their classrooms. Educators should strive to create an environment that values curiosity, questioning, and constructive feedback. By modeling critical thinking behaviors and encouraging students to challenge assumptions, instructors can inspire a mindset of inquiry. Moreover, faculty can incorporate real-world scenarios into their lessons, prompting students to analyze situations critically and consider various perspectives. Collaborative learning is another effective approach for cultivating critical thinking skills. When students work together on projects or case studies, they are exposed to diverse viewpoints and ideas. This collaborative process encourages them to articulate their thoughts, engage in constructive debates, and learn from their peers. For instance, in a business course, students might work in groups to develop a marketing strategy for a new product, requiring them to evaluate market research and consider the implications of their decisions. The integration of technology in the classroom can also enhance the development of critical thinking skills. Digital tools and resources, such as online discussion forums, simulations, and data analysis software, provide opportunities for students to engage in analytical thinking. For example, students studying data science can use software to analyze real datasets, drawing conclusions and making recommendations based on their findings. By leveraging technology, universities can create interactive learning environments that foster critical thinking.
